Today, it is still possible to find gold in the Australian Outback by panning in creeks, streams and rivers, which is a method that leads prospectors to significant placer deposits every year. But metal detecting for gold nuggets on the surface and beneath the ground has become the most profitable way to search for gold in Australia for smaller mining operations and prospectors.

MoreDuring the Australian gold rushes, starting in 1851, significant numbers of workers moved from elsewhere in Australia and overseas to where gold had been discovered. Gold had been found several times before but the colonial government of New South Wales (Victoria did not become a separate colony until 1 July 1851) had suppressed the news out of the fear that it would reduce the workforce and ...

More30-01-2019 The largest gold mine outside of Western Australia, Evolution’s Cowal mine is located 350km west of Sydney, in New South Wales. Production has fluctuated over the last decade, from a low of 191,000 ounces in 2008 to a high of 314,000 in 2013, and down again to the 2018 total of 258,000.
